Leeds United attacking midfielder Pablo Hernandez is not resting up over the summer break and has been training with lower league Spanish side UD Castellon. 

Hernandez, who recently put pen to paper to a new contract to stay at Leeds, is part of the ownership group at Castellon.




He has taken advantage of the fact that the Spanish side's season is still going by regularly attending training with the squad.

Hernandez has been keeping sharp as he bids to make sure he reports back to Thorp Arch in the best possible shape.
 


Castellon are involved in the promotion playoffs which stretch until late June, as they bid to win promotion to the Segunda Division B.

They saw off Tropezon 4-1 on Sunday in front of 12,000 fans to continue their run in the playoffs.

The first leg ended 1-1 at Tropezon, but Castellon made no mistake in the return as a hat-trick from Cristian Herrera helped the side get the job done.
